Default 200 Soft Brakes

I replaced Rotors, Calipers, pads, and brake lines on 2 wheels.
Bled lines a few time. Test drive brakes feel good, but after driving a bit, brake seems to go to the floor easily. When I release pedal, brake is hard again.
Any suggestions??

1st, impressive mileage.
2nd, master cylinder?
wife's 05 Sebring has the same symptoms, and i've noted that the rear brakes are more than 50% wore out compared to the practically new fronts (both are the same age.) that tells me she's stopping on the back.
if I pump the pedal it gets stiff and it stops much better, so it's not always grabbing the fronts correctly. I've scheduled to do the master, as like you i've done just about everything else that makes sense.
